Claude Code macOS 설치 방법 2026 — M1, M2, M3 칩별 주의사항 정리
macOS에서 Claude Code 설치, 가장 쉬운 환경이다
세 가지 운영체제 중 Claude Code를 설치하기 가장 편한 환경은 macOS입니다. WSL 같은 별도의 사전 작업 없이 터미널에서 명령어 한 줄로 설치가 끝납니다.
다만 최근 Apple이 Intel 칩에서 Apple Silicon(M1, M2, M3) 칩으로 전환하면서 몇 가지 확인해야 할 사항이 생겼습니다. 칩 종류에 따라 설치 환경이 조금씩 다르고, 일부 도구와의 호환성에서 주의할 점이 있습니다.
이 글에서는 macOS 환경에서 Claude Code를 설치하는 방법을 2026년 기준으로 정리하고, M1, M2, M3 칩 사용자가 특히 확인해야 할 사항을 함께 안내합니다.
설치 전 확인사항
내 Mac의 칩 종류 확인하기
화면 왼쪽 상단 Apple 로고를 클릭한 뒤 이 Mac에 관하여를 선택합니다. 개요 탭에서 칩 항목을 확인하면 됩니다.
- Apple M1, M2, M3, M4로 표시되면 Apple Silicon 칩입니다.
- Intel Core i5, i7, i9 등으로 표시되면 Intel 칩입니다.
macOS 버전 확인하기
같은 화면에서 macOS 버전도 확인할 수 있습니다. Claude Code는 최신 macOS 버전에서 가장 안정적으로 작동합니다. 가능하면 최신 버전으로 업데이트한 뒤 설치하는 것을 권장합니다.
터미널 열기
macOS에서 터미널을 여는 방법은 두 가지입니다.
첫 번째는 Spotlight 검색을 이용하는 방법입니다. Command + Space를 누르고 터미널을 입력한 뒤 엔터를 누르면 됩니다.
두 번째는 Finder를 이용하는 방법입니다. 응용 프로그램 폴더에서 유틸리티 폴더를 열면 터미널 앱을 찾을 수 있습니다.
터미널 대신 iTerm2를 사용하는 분도 많습니다. iTerm2는 macOS 기본 터미널보다 기능이 많고 편리해서 개발자들이 선호하는 터미널 앱입니다. Claude Code는 기본 터미널과 iTerm2 모두에서 정상적으로 작동합니다.
Claude Code 설치 — 명령어 한 줄로 끝난다
터미널을 열고 아래 명령어를 입력합니다.
curl -fsSL https://claude.ai/install.sh | bash
엔터를 누르면 설치가 자동으로 진행됩니다. 인터넷 연결 속도에 따라 수십 초에서 1~2분 정도 소요됩니다. 설치가 완료되면 터미널에 완료 메시지가 표시됩니다.
설치 후 아래 명령어로 정상 설치 여부를 확인합니다.
claude --version
버전 번호가 출력되면 설치가 정상적으로 완료된 것입니다.
Homebrew를 이용한 설치 방법
macOS 개발자라면 Homebrew를 이미 사용하고 있을 가능성이 높습니다. Homebrew를 통해서도 Claude Code를 설치할 수 있습니다.
brew install --cask claude-code
다만 Homebrew 설치 방식은 자동 업데이트가 되지 않는다는 점을 알아두세요. 새 버전이 출시됐을 때 아래 명령어로 수동으로 업데이트해야 합니다.
brew upgrade claude-code
또한 업그레이드 후에도 이전 버전이 디스크에 남아있어 용량을 차지할 수 있습니다. 주기적으로 아래 명령어를 실행해 정리해주는 것이 좋습니다.
brew cleanup claude-code
네이티브 설치 방식(curl 명령어)은 백그라운드에서 자동으로 업데이트되기 때문에, 별도의 관리가 번거롭다면 curl 방식을 사용하는 것이 편합니다.
M1, M2, M3 칩 사용자 주의사항
Apple Silicon 칩 사용자라면 아래 사항을 확인해야 합니다.
Rosetta 2 설치 여부 확인
일부 도구들이 아직 Apple Silicon을 완전히 지원하지 않아 Rosetta 2를 통해 Intel 버전으로 실행되는 경우가 있습니다. Claude Code 자체는 Apple Silicon을 지원하지만, 함께 사용하는 다른 도구가 Rosetta 2를 필요로 할 수 있습니다.
Rosetta 2가 설치되어 있지 않다면 아래 명령어로 설치할 수 있습니다.
softwareupdate --install-rosetta
Homebrew 경로 확인
Apple Silicon Mac에서 Homebrew를 사용하는 경우 설치 경로가 Intel Mac과 다릅니다.
- Intel Mac: /usr/local
- Apple Silicon Mac: /opt/homebrew
Homebrew를 통해 설치한 도구가 정상적으로 인식되지 않는다면 경로 설정을 확인해야 합니다. 아래 명령어를 .zshrc 파일에 추가하면 해결되는 경우가 많습니다.
eval "$(/opt/homebrew/bin/brew shellenv)"
메모리 관리
M1, M2, M3 칩은 통합 메모리 구조를 사용합니다. 대규모 프로젝트를 Claude Code로 처리할 때 메모리 사용량이 높아질 수 있습니다. 8GB 모델보다 16GB 이상 모델에서 더 쾌적하게 작동합니다.
로그인 설정
설치 완료 후 터미널에서 아래 명령어를 입력해 Claude Code를 실행합니다.
claude
처음 실행하면 브라우저가 자동으로 열리면서 Claude.ai 로그인 화면이 나타납니다. Pro 플랜 이상의 계정으로 로그인하면 터미널과 자동으로 연동됩니다.
로그인이 완료되면 브라우저를 닫고 터미널로 돌아오면 바로 사용할 수 있습니다.
자동 업데이트 설정
네이티브 설치 방식으로 설치한 경우 Claude Code는 백그라운드에서 자동으로 업데이트됩니다. 별도로 업데이트 명령어를 입력할 필요가 없습니다.
자동 업데이트 채널은 두 가지입니다.
- latest: 새 기능이 출시되는 즉시 업데이트됩니다. 최신 기능을 빠르게 사용하고 싶은 분에게 적합합니다.
- stable: 출시 후 약 1주일이 지난 안정화된 버전을 사용합니다. 안정성을 우선시하는 분에게 적합합니다.
기본값은 latest입니다. stable 채널로 변경하고 싶다면 설정 파일에서 autoUpdatesChannel 값을 stable로 변경하면 됩니다.
macOS 설치 시 자주 겪는 문제
curl 명령어 실행 시 권한 오류가 발생한다
macOS 보안 설정으로 인해 발생하는 경우가 있습니다. 시스템 설정에서 개인 정보 보호 및 보안 항목을 확인하고, 터미널의 접근 권한을 허용해주면 해결됩니다.
claude 명령어를 입력했는데 찾을 수 없다고 나온다
터미널을 완전히 닫고 다시 열어서 시도해보세요. 그래도 해결되지 않는다면 사용 중인 셸 설정 파일(.zshrc 또는 .bashrc)에 PATH 설정이 제대로 되어 있는지 확인해야 합니다.
zsh를 사용하는 경우 아래 명령어로 설정 파일을 다시 불러옵니다.
source ~/.zshrc
Homebrew로 설치했는데 버전이 오래됐다고 표시된다
Homebrew 방식은 자동 업데이트가 되지 않습니다. 아래 명령어로 수동 업데이트를 진행하세요.
brew upgrade claude-code
업그레이드가 실패하는 경우 새 버전이 아직 Homebrew에 반영되지 않은 것일 수 있습니다. 잠시 기다렸다가 다시 시도해보세요.
VS Code와 연동하기
macOS 환경에서 VS Code와 Claude Code를 함께 사용하는 방법은 간단합니다. VS Code를 열고 내장 터미널(Control + 백틱)을 실행한 뒤 claude 명령어를 입력하면 됩니다.
VS Code 내장 터미널은 macOS 기본 터미널과 동일한 환경이기 때문에 별도의 설정 없이 바로 사용할 수 있습니다. VS Code에서 코드를 보면서 Claude Code로 명령을 내리는 방식으로 작업하면 두 도구의 장점을 모두 활용할 수 있습니다.
마무리
macOS는 Claude Code를 설치하기 가장 간단한 환경입니다. 명령어 한 줄로 설치가 끝나고, Apple Silicon 칩을 사용하는 경우에도 몇 가지 사항만 확인하면 문제없이 사용할 수 있습니다.
설치 후 바로 프로젝트 폴더에서 claude 명령어를 실행해보세요. 처음 몇 가지 명령어를 입력해보는 것만으로도 Claude Code가 어떤 도구인지 빠르게 파악할 수 있습니다. 다음 글에서는 Claude Code를 VS Code와 연동하는 방법을 설정부터 실전 활용까지 자세하게 정리해드리겠습니다.
다음 글 예고: Claude Code VS Code 연동 방법 2026 — 설정부터 실전 활용까지
8번 글로 바로 이어서 작성할까요? “네”라고 답해주시면 진행하겠습니다.